Venice in a Nutshell

Venice is not merely a destination; it is an experience that honours the old with the new in a way few places can. In this remarkable city, the interplay of water, stone and human ingenuity creates an atmosphere that is both enchanting and refreshingly genuine. As you wander along the labyrinthine network of canals, you encounter a mix of centuries-old architecture, lively markets and quiet corners where the pace of life slows to a gentle rhythm. Here, the past is never far away, from the imposing façade of St Mark’s Basilica to the intricate details of hidden chapels, every stone tells a story.

The city’s layout, built on more than 100 islands, means that bridges and water transport are integral to everyday life. Rather than feeling isolated, the network of vaporetto routes and narrow passageways creates a sense of intimate connection between the various districts, known as sestieri. This distinctive structure allows visitors to experience Venice in a relaxed and personal manner. Whether you are sampling local cicchetti in a family-run bacaro or taking in the sunset from a quiet canal, you soon realise that Venice offers more than the typical tourist scenes. It provides a genuine insight into a way of life that values simplicity, craft and community.

Art and culture have always been at the heart of Venice. Famous for its role in the Renaissance, the city continues to inspire artists, writers and filmmakers worldwide. While popular films capture the romantic allure of Venice, the real beauty lies in its everyday life: the echo of footsteps on ancient stone, the murmur of local conversations and the subtle beauty of weathered facades.

Local traditions shine during events like the Venice Carnival, when the city bursts into a celebration of masks, costumes and live street performances. Such festivals, along with the regular rhythm of daily life in bustling markets and quiet squares, reveal a side of Venice that is both festive and deeply rooted in history. For travellers seeking an escape that combines cultural heritage, famous food and a relaxed pace, Venice stands out as a place where everything feels authentic. Each experience here, from a leisurely stroll along the canals to an intimate dinner in a centuries-old osteria, adds a unique chapter to your journey. Venice invites you to discover its many layers in this living, breathing masterpiece.

For those who want genuine local experiences, Venice always delivers. Venture off the beaten path to find small workshops where age-old crafts are still practised and enjoy a meal in a cosy family-run trattoria. The city’s rich history and creative pulse invite you to write your own chapter in its ongoing story, ensuring every visit is a personal discovery.
